AmpliForge vs Taplio

Taplio helps you write and schedule LinkedIn posts and grow a personal brand. AmpliForge runs the full content supply chain — with EU data residency and GDPR compliance.

Taplio and AmpliForge both help you publish on LinkedIn, but they solve different problems. Taplio centres on writing, scheduling and engaging with LinkedIn text posts, while AmpliForge runs the full content supply chain — ingesting webinars, podcasts and documents — on EU-native, GDPR-compliant infrastructure.

The verdict

Choose Taplio if you're a creator or personal brand who mainly needs to write, schedule and grow on LinkedIn. Choose AmpliForge if you're a B2B team that needs the whole pipeline — source ingestion, brand-voice RAG, LinkedIn publishing and CTA/UTM attribution — with EU data residency.

Frequently asked questions

Is Taplio GDPR-compliant and EU-hosted?

Taplio is operated by lempire in France, but its privacy policy states data is transferred to and processed in the United States, so no EU data residency is stated. AmpliForge is EU-native with EU storage and an Article 28 GDPR DPA.

What does AmpliForge do that Taplio doesn't?

AmpliForge ingests and repurposes source assets like webinars, podcasts and documents across a full pipeline, adds CTA/UTM click attribution, and redacts PII before every third-party AI call. Taplio focuses on writing, scheduling and engagement for LinkedIn posts.

How much does each cost?

Taplio ranges from $39 to $199/mo, though AI writing starts on the $65/mo Standard tier, with roughly 25% off annual billing and a 7-day free trial. AmpliForge is in private beta with founding pricing and a 7-day free trial.
